Inside the gate: Lake Nakuru Lodge sits within the national park itself, so game drives start from the car park. No queue at the gate in the morning and no six o'clock deadline, which gives you first and last light on every one of your three days.

Kenya's first rhino sanctuary: Fenced and compact, this is one of the most reliable places in the country to see both black and white rhino. Rothschild's giraffe, one of the rarest giraffe subspecies left in the wild, browse the acacia woodland here alongside lion, leopard and buffalo.

Rooms that face the lake: All rooms open onto a private balcony or patio with lake or escarpment views, with a separate sitting area and a deep soaking bath. There is a pool, a poolside bar, a terrace restaurant and a treatment room on site.

Full board, so nothing is transactional: Breakfast, lunch and dinner are included for both of you across the whole stay, from arrival lunch to departure breakfast. Nobody signs for anything on their honeymoon.

The Cliff, if you want it: The Cliff is a ten suite tented camp built along a hundred metre cliff face inside the same national park, with an infinity pool at the edge, an Africology spa, freestanding baths facing the lake and a farm to fork kitchen. Day 1: Nairobi to Lake Nakuru National Park

Morning: Leaving on your own time
Pickup from your Nairobi home or hotel at 7:00 am, or later if you would rather sleep. The road runs northwest and climbs onto the Rift Valley escarpment, where the viewpoint opens onto the whole valley floor with Longonot and Suswa out on the plain. Your driver guide will stop for as long as you want.

Afternoon: Checking in
Through the park gate and in to the lodge, roughly three hours from Nairobi with the stop. Check in, lunch on the terrace, then the afternoon is yours. Most couples spend this one asleep, and there is no reason not to.

Evening: First game drive
Out with the roof open as the heat drops, down toward the lake shore where the animals come to water. Buffalo in the open, waterbuck in the shallows and a real chance at white rhino on the first drive. Dinner back at the lodge.

Day 2: The early day

Morning: First light
An early start with coffee before you leave. The hour after sunrise is when predators are still moving and when the park belongs entirely to the people staying inside it. Your driver guide works the rhino territory and the acacia line where Rothschild's giraffe browse. Back for a long breakfast whenever you want it.

Afternoon: Baboon Cliff and the drowned forest
A slow midday at the pool, then out again as the light turns. The road climbs to Baboon Cliff and Lion Hill, looking down across the whole lake and the bare acacia trunks standing in the shallow water, with fish eagles and great white pelicans working the branches.

Evening: Your dinner
A private table arranged in advance, away from the main restaurant, with whatever you have added waiting when you sit down.

Day 3: The day with nothing in it

Morning: The alarm stays off
This is the day that separates a honeymoon from a long weekend. Breakfast at nine, the pool, the balcony, a book. Nobody is coming to get you.

Afternoon: Whatever you feel like
The vehicle is here on this day too, so you can go out for a full afternoon drive on a route you have not used, take the road down to Makalia Falls at the southern end of the park if the water is running, or drive into Nakuru town and back. Or ignore all of it and stay where you are.

Evening: Sundowner
The escarpment at the end of the day, with a sundowner set up at a viewpoint if you have added one, and dinner on the terrace afterwards with the lake dark below.

Day 4: Last drive and the road home

Morning: One more loop
A final early game drive before breakfast, on a route you have not taken yet. By the fourth day you both know where things usually are, which changes how the drive feels.

Afternoon: Back to Nairobi
Breakfast, checkout, and out through the gate for the drive south, with your van dropping you at your Nairobi address in the mid afternoon.

What To Carry

Original national ID or passport for each of you, which KWS now requires at the gate. Photocopies and phone photos are not accepted and anyone without originals is charged the full non resident rate regardless of what the receipt says
If either of you has changed a name since the wedding, travel on the document the name has not changed on yet, because KWS matches the original to the ticket
Warm layer or fleece for early morning drives, because the Rift Valley floor is cold before sunrise
Neutral coloured clothing in khaki, beige or olive for game drives
Closed shoes for the viewpoints, where the ground is loose rock
